Tagesschau is the flagship news program of the German public broadcaster ARD. It is broadcast daily at 8:00 PM on Das Erste and is also available online and via various ARD channels. The program typically covers major national and international news, including politics, economics, and social issues. Tagesschau has a long history, first airing in 1952, and is known for its objective reporting and in-depth analysis. It plays a significant role in informing the German public and shaping public discourse. The broadcast often includes segments on sports and weather, providing a comprehensive overview of current events. Its online presence has grown significantly, with a dedicated website and app offering news updates and video content. Tagesschau's commitment to journalistic standards has made it a trusted source of information for millions of viewers.
